Playing its final game against a team from north of Interstate 35E until a prospective state tournament appearance, the Lakeville North boys soccer team hosts fifth-ranked Bloomington Jefferson in the regular-season finale on Thursday night.
PLAYERS TO WATCH
Tyler David entered the week with the team scoring lead at eight goals through 13 games, with Joey Decklever and Toby Khounviseth each logging five goals each heading into the final two-game stretch. Goalkeeper Connor Revsbeck had seven shutouts in 13 games entering the week.
Jefferson is led by Tyler Anderson (11 goals) and Tyler Tumberg (eight goals), while goalie William Elfstrum has stopped 108 of 119 shots through 14 games and had six shutouts entering the week.
WHO WILL WIN:
While Jefferson is the ranked team, North trails the Jaguars by just a skosh record-wise. Jefferson began October with an 8-2-4 overall record, 4-1-2 in the South Suburban Conference, while the Panthers were 8-3-2 overall, 4-2-1 in the SSC.
Both teams were tied for second in the conference in least goals allowed at an average of 0.8 each as they started the week, with Jefferson holding a slight scoring edge at 2.3 per game to North’s 1.9 average.
Each squad fell to likely conference champion Eastview by a single goal and each had a .500 record against ranked teams through September.
